The smoke finally cleared off enough to give me a chance to try out my new mono-astro camera. This image of the Andromeda galaxy was made by stacking groups of shots taken with a Luminance, Red, Green and Blue filter. These groups where then combined to produce a full color image. Due to the large size of Andromeda I used a 500mm Canon lens rather than a standard telescope. I also used a homemade adapter to attach the filter wheel and astro-camera to the Canon lens. Many of the subframes had satellites go through while the exposures were being taken, fortunately it is fairly easy to filter out most of the satellite trails (I did end up doing a small amount of cleaning with a clone tool).
The first image is the end result, in download and double download you can see the darker dust lanes in the galaxy and several of its bright blue star clusters. This image required ~6 hours of total exposure.
The next image is same except I went though and circled a number of dim galaxies in background (probably most of these are many 100's of millions of light years away). The red circle shows where I believe I found 1 dim galaxy and the yellow circle is where two or more distant galaxies showed up. This was just a cursory examination and there are certainly many more that could be found. A few of the circles also have PGC numbers of the galaxies in the circles (only a few of them showed up in my charts). You will probably need to use a the double down load to pick out these dim galaxies.
The last images is one of the subframes that shows one of the pesky satellite trails.

When I was young the Palomar Observatory Hale Telescope in 1949 became a reality, I was fascinated. During WW2 and my living in the country, the sky was not polluted with city or street lights the sky was crystal clear on some nights and one could only stare skyward and imagine. For our camera/lens/software technology to have advanced so far as to provide you with the ability to take these images is miraculous. Photo #2 shows your dedication, taking the time to show us the dim galaxies.

Photo #3 with the "pesky satellite trails" reminds me of the worldwide fascination with Echo, a huge [100'] Mylar/Aluminum coated balloon put in orbit in 1960. The schedule was in every newspaper so you knew when to look skyward. Perhaps we need such a second moon to make the space program connect with the people. I am glued to the SpaceX rapid advance copying the shining ships of 1960's SiFi space movies. Echo was actually suggested by Arthur C. Clarke the famous futurist SiFi writer.
